Helen Suzanne Alexander – Scotland
Fibre art and oil paintings with inspiration taken from the wild and beautiful natural environments of the Scottish West Coast Islands. Helen works with her own hand dyed fibres and fabrics and mixes them with a variety of other materials to capture the colours and textures of her coastal moorland home.

Janette Boskett - UK
Janette loves to combine the twin genres of still-life and landscape and then apply a gently surreal twist. She has a passion for odd and quirky objects but is also inspired by the wonderful surroundings of the North York Moors where she lives and works.
